Explore the Lucky 38 and meet Mr. House in fallout new vegas. Recover the Platinum Chip and upgrade your Presidential Suite for over 100 Caps each.
Walkthrough
- 1Approach The Lucky 38 casino. Speak with Victor outside, who will direct you inside.
- 2On the casino floor, head west behind some stairs to find Cartons of Cigarettes and four Safes full of loot, particularly chems.
- 3Go up the nearby stairs and search behind a bar counter for Nuka-Cola, Sunset Sarsaparilla, and Whiskey. Above these, you'll find the Golden Gloves (unique Boxing Gloves) in front of a Boxing Times issue.
- 4On the ground floor, head east behind another bar for more food and beverages.
- 5Find another Victor-bot near an elevator across from the entrance. Take it to the Penthouse.
- 6Speak with Jane, a Securitron, and ask about Mr. House’s Snowglobe collection. You should have Snowglobes for Goodsprings, Nellis AFB, Mt. Charleston, the Mormon Fort, and The Strip.
- 7Head south down some stairs, then east through a curtain to find Mr. House on a monitor.
- 8Activate the console under his monitor to speak with him. He explains that an employee robbed him and you need to recover the Platinum Chip from Benny. He offers you four times the stated pay on your contract, which is 1,000 Caps.
- 9Pass a [Barter 50] check to increase the pay to 1,250 Caps and agree to the deal.
- 10After speaking with Mr. House, you can ask him questions about Benny, the families of New Vegas, and the Platinum Chip. Passing a [Speech 50] check when asking about the Platinum Chip reveals it has a use tied to computers. Passing a [Medicine 35] check when asking about him reveals he is over 200 years old.
- 11Return to the elevator and speak with Victor to receive a comped suite.
- 12Travel to the Presidential Suite. Access the terminal in the hall to purchase upgrades: two Crafting Lockers, a Fridge, two Guest Wardrobes, two Master Wardrobes, a Sunset Sarsaparilla Vending Machine, two Weapon Trunks, and a Work Bench. Each costs just over 100 Caps.
- 13Head down to the Cocktail Lounge. Search every Cash Register for Pre-War money. On the northern side of the ring, behind a Cash Register, find the Snow Globe - Test Site.
- 14Exit The Lucky 38. You will gain The Strip Fame and an NCR Trooper will direct you to meet Ambassador Crocker (this is part of the pro-NCR ending).
Tips
- The Presidential Suite offers storage, beds, water, and crafting stations after purchasing upgrades.
- The Snow Globe - Test Site is the second-to-last Snow Globe to collect. The final one is at Hoover Dam.
- After exiting The Lucky 38, you may be directed to meet Ambassador Crocker as part of a potential pro-NCR storyline.
